body{font-size:14px}


@media only screen and (max-width: 1200px), only screen and (max-device-width: 1200px){
	html{font-size:30px}
	
body{
  

  
overflow-x: hidden;
}
	.width1200{
		width:90%!important;
		margin: 0 auto;
	}
	.fl{
		/* float: none; */
	}
	.fr{
		/*float: none;*/
	}
	.tzgz_banner{
		height: auto;
		padding-bottom: 20%;
	}
	.ysgz_nav ul.ysmenu li.nLi {
		width: 33% !important;
	}
	.ysgz_nav{
		display: flex;
		
	}
	.ysgz_nav ul.ysmenu{
		width: 90%;
		margin: 0 auto;
		position: relative;
		z-index: 999;
	}
	.yshj{
		height: auto;
	}

	.ysgz_nav ul.ysmenu li.nLi h3 a {
		
		font-size: 16px;
		
	}
	
	.ysdt_picnews {
		width: 48%;

	}

	.ysdt_news{
	    width: 68%!important;
	}
	.tzgz_box .ysdt_news{
	    width: 49%!important;
	}

	.ysdt_news {
		width:100%;
	}
	.zczd a {
    	display: block;
    	width: 100%;
     	height:auto; 
    	padding: 28% 0;
	}
	.zczd{
		min-height: auto;
	}

	.ej_left{
		width: 30%;
	}
	.width1200 {
	    width: 98%!important;
	    margin: 40px auto;
	}
	.ysdt_list {
    overflow: initial!important;
}


	
}

@media only screen and (max-width: 690px), only screen and (max-device-width: 690px){
	.home_tpxw_slide,.home_video_slide {
	    height: 217px;
	}
	.fl{
		 float: none; 
	}
	.fr{
		float: none;
	}
	.ej_left{
		width: 100%;
		float: none;
	}

	.ysdt_picnews {
		width: 100%;

	}
	.ysdt_news{
	    width: 100%!important;
	}
	.tzgz_box .ysdt_news {
    width: 100%!important;
}
	.wzjd_tit li a{
		font-size: 20px;
	}

	.logo img{
		width: 60%;
	}

	.ej_show {
	    padding: 10px;
	}
	.wzjd_tit{
		margin-bottom: 0px;
		margin-top: 10px;
	}
	.ysdt_list li {
	    position: relative;
	    padding: 0 100px 0 16px;
	    height: 40px;
	    line-height: 40px;
	    overflow: hidden;
	    vertical-align: top;
	}
	
}


@media only screen and (max-width: 600px), only screen and (max-device-width: 600px){
	.ysdt_list li a {
   
	    font-size: 14px;
	}
	.ysdt_list li span {
	  
	    font-size: 14px;
	}
	.qybs .bd{
		width: 95%;
		margin:0 auto;
	}
	.qybs .bd ul li{
		width: 100%;
		box-shadow: 0px 0px 0px 0px rgba(0, 86, 154, 0.26)
	}
}